aboutsummaryrefslogtreecommitdiffstats
path: root/recipes/python/python-2.6.5/99-ignore-optimization-flag.patch
blob: dcee1127d472d015ddcbdd30b1da37664902d506 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
# Reinstate the empty -O option to fix weird mixing of native and target
# binaries and libraries with LD_LIBRARY_PATH when host==target
#
# Signed-off-by: Denys Dmytriyenko <denis@denix.org>

diff -uNr Python-2.6.5.orig//Modules/main.c Python-2.6.5/Modules/main.c
--- Python-2.6.5.orig//Modules/main.c	2009-10-27 13:48:52.000000000 +0100
+++ Python-2.6.5/Modules/main.c	2010-08-16 21:25:04.000000000 +0200
@@ -328,8 +328,7 @@
 
 		/* case 'J': reserved for Jython */
 
-		case 'O':
-			Py_OptimizeFlag++;
+		case 'O': /* ignore it */
 			break;
 
 		case 'B':